On Wednesday afternoon CE Software Inc. will post a beta version of QuicKeys X that will work on Mac OS X 10.3 (“Panther”), which goes on sale Friday.
QuicKeys X is an automation utility for Mac OS X. You can use it to record the keystrokes and mouse clicks you use for common operations, then play them back as needed. You can assign tasks to be linked to hot keys, toolbar buttons, menu selections, or configure them as timed events.
The current version, QuicKeys X2, costs US$99.95. A 30-day demo version — as well as the Panther-compatible beta — can be downloaded from the CE Software Web site.
